- The distance between Souda/ Khania, Greece and Alice Springs, Australia is approximately 13,243 km or 8,229 mi.
- To reach Souda/ Khania in this distance one would set out from Alice Springs bearing 298.7° or WN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Souda/ Khania bearing 279.8° or W .
- Souda/ Khania has a Mediterranean hot climate (Csa) whereas Alice Springs has a subtropical hot desert climate (BWh).
- Souda/ Khania is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ome whereas Alice Springs is in or near the subtropical desert scrub biome.
- The mean temperature is 2.7 °C (4.9°F) cooler.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 1.6 °C (2.9°F) less in Souda/ Khania.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ic for both.
- Total annual precipitation averages 350.7 mm (13.8 in) more which is equivalent to 350.7 l/m² (8.61 US gal/ft²) or 3,507,000 l/ha (374,922 US gal/ac) more. About 2 1/6 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 10.8° lower in Souda/ Khania than in Alice Springs.
